Which racquet does Sindhu use?

Sponsored by Yonex, Sindhu uses the popular Duora Z-Strike which perfectly suits her attacking and dominating style of play. Duora Z-Strike is an offensive racket specially made to boost power, speed and control. It gives players a tactical upper hand on the court. It helps players command the game on the court.

What is U and G in badminton racket?

U indicates the weight of the racket. G indicates the size of the grip handle.

Which is better light or heavy badminton racket?

Racket weight is a personal preference, but a head heavier racket does add more power if you have enough strength to control the racket. Head heavier rackets are not suited for all players. Lighter rackets are easier to control, but you give up some power if they are too light.

Which pound badminton racket is best?

For average players, 22-26 lbs will be good enough. Over-loose string will cause the string bed to be too bouncy, and hence make the control of your shot execution harder. On the other hand, modern rackets are light but they are fragile too.
